Also a cover with letter both on mourning stationary, President James A.Garfield's widow Lucretia R. Garfield, on March 7th, 1882, after her husband the Presedant was assassinated, wrote this letter to my great, great, grandfather Levi L. Burdon. This cover contaians a letter of thanks to the " Fifth Rhode Island and Battery Veterans Association" for a tribute plaque that the Association had sent.
